hey guys.  ok, i feel that i have an exhaust leak & im pretty sure its coming from the rear end of my cat.  so i got a new gasket & am going to replace the old one(which i hope will correct the problem).  now what i wanna know is, is it as easy as i think it is?  unscrew bolts, remove old gasket, put in new one, & re-tighten bolts?  or am i missing something?  also, do i still have to use gasket sealer even though im putting in a brand-new gasket?  any help is appreciated,thanks!

SSJ2Gohan
10-23-2002, 06:04 AM
That's pretty much all there is too it.  Just soak those bolts in some wd-40.  Id say if you can replace the bolts if they are rusted real bad.  Since they are so cheap I always replace the stock bolts whenever I do something new.

I dont think you need gasket sealer.  Probably wouldnt hurt anything to do it though.
